Berau Coal to increase export to India

Friday, June 10 2011 - 04:25 AM WIB

East Kalimantan coal miner PT Berau Coal, a unit of PT Berau Coal Energy Tbk, plans to produce 23 million tonnes in 2012, a 15 percent increase from 20 million tonnes this year.

About 45 percent of the production will be shipped to China and India, said Eko B.F Natalina, the firm?s General Manager of Marketing.

?China and India will lead demand in the future. China was quite silent in the first quarter of this year, but they are coming back. I believe next year they will consume a significant amount of coal,? said Natalina, adding that the firm was on track to produce 30 million tonnes of coal by 2014.

Berau expects its coal shipments to China next year to be steady at between 5.5-6 million tonnes, he said.

Berau will ship 2.5-3 million tonnes of coal to India in 2012, rising from planned exports of 2 million tonnes this year, said Natalina, adding that the firm was negotiating with one or two new Indian buyers. (denny/fitri)
